Semaglutide is a modified glucagon-like peptide-1 (GLP-1) receptor agonist consisting of 31 amino acids with strategic modifications at positions 8 (Aib substitution) and 26 (C-18 fatty diacid acylation via a linker) that confer extended stability and a plasma half-life of approximately 165 hours. Its molecular weight is approximately 4,113 Da.
Semaglutide is among the most extensively studied peptides in metabolic research. Clinical investigations have examined its binding affinity for the GLP-1 receptor (GLP-1R), a class B G-protein-coupled receptor expressed in pancreatic beta cells, the gastrointestinal tract, and central nervous system regions involved in appetite regulation. Research has documented its effects on glucose-dependent insulin secretion, glucagon suppression, and gastric emptying kinetics. Preclinical and clinical studies have also investigated its interactions with hypothalamic appetite circuits and potential neuroprotective properties.
The mechanism of action involves high-affinity GLP-1R binding, triggering cAMP-dependent signaling cascades that modulate insulin granule exocytosis, beta-cell gene transcription, and central satiety signaling via vagal afferent and hypothalamic pathways.
